Efficient and thermally stable inverted perovskite solar cells by introduction of non-fullerene electron transporting materials
説明
<p>Highly efficient and thermally stable inverted MAPbI3 and FAPbI3−xBr<italic>x</italic> perovskite planar solar cells are demonstrated by using a <italic>N</italic>,<italic>N</italic>′-bis(phenylmethyl)naphthalene-1,4,5,8-tetracarboxylicdiimide (NDI-PM)-based electron transporting material (ETM) instead of a conventional PCBM-based ETM.</p>
